Subject: [PATCH] mac80211: drop check for DONT_REORDER in __ieee80211_select_queue

When __ieee80211_select_queue is called, skb->cb has not been cleared yet,
which means that info->control.flags can contain garbage.
In some cases this leads to IEEE80211_TX_CTRL_DONT_REORDER being set, causing
packets marked for other queues to randomly end up in BE instead.
This flag only needs to be checked in ieee80211_select_queue_80211, since
the radiotap parser is the only piece of code that sets it

net/mac80211/wme.c | 3 +--
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/net/mac80211/wme.c b/net/mac80211/wme.c
index 9ea6004abe1b..62c6733e0792 100644
--- a/net/mac80211/wme.c
+++ b/net/mac80211/wme.c
@@ -143,7 +143,6 @@ u16 ieee80211_select_queue_80211(struct ieee80211_sub_if_data *sdata,
u16 __ieee80211_select_queue(struct ieee80211_sub_if_data *sdata,
struct sta_info *sta, struct sk_buff *skb)
{
- struct ieee80211_tx_info *info = IEEE80211_SKB_CB(skb);
struct mac80211_qos_map *qos_map;
bool qos;
@@ -156,7 +155,7 @@ u16 __ieee80211_select_queue(struct ieee80211_sub_if_data *sdata,
else
qos = false;
- if (!qos || (info->control.flags & IEEE80211_TX_CTRL_DONT_REORDER)) {
+ if (!qos) {
skb->priority = 0; /* required for correct WPA/11i MIC */
return IEEE80211_AC_BE;
}
